Panathinaikos assistant manager Roberto Muzzi confirms “we are in talks for Victor Ibarbo” with Roma.

The Colombian striker spent this season on loan at Watford and then Atletico Nacional.

“We are in talks for Ibarbo, despite the fact he didn’t do terribly well at Roma, I am convinced he can do very well with us,” Muzzi told Radio Centro Suono.

“We are also seeking a few youngsters from Serie A. We also tracked Seydou Doumbia, who impressed me at the start, but to be honest he’s fallen by the wayside over the past two years.”

Muzzi is assistant manager to Panathinaikos Coach Andrea Stramaccioni.

“Andrea and I will remain at Panathinaikos, as we have another two years on our contracts. However, there is a release clause if a big club makes a proposal.

“We are working on the transfer market and hope to become a big club on a European level too. The Pana stadium is wonderful and, despite what people say, Greek football is growing with many important players.

“The Pana fans are twinned with Roma ultras and always show the Giallorossi flag in the Curva.”
